Type
ORACLE
Validation date
2024-03-22 16:34: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03561,
    "usd": 0.03851
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013CA8B671583086930AA79EDC630F52CE7B94D20FE73C277FCC52F4DC98C22C67

Previous signature

590155045A664F6842304276386B6ECBFB2D077CF0C1B631D467347507AD92ED3CEAA7635173EACA6F1395854245E1D3DEA3D25D89519D7C291287BEAC03EA03

Origin signature

30440220168E41B9EE004954DB713AE90425BDEBBDA8280ABAC01B700EF5A2D19CD63D9302201DE04784DEFBF1D29A9091EF5BFFBE308F7FD31DF05F002E5A910D0D5FDA6AE2

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00967564E412A9ED555F41EE6365A73DEED25564AEA4D8C6C80CF0B946E6BF41F3

Coordinator signature

75D0D526B82A68CD3B5D0F64A48C64B33533AEB7A1B0135BF15782065BB737D934753800352711B24280DE22E48DD2529B52DFA7E8DF1FA6F31F846801935D06

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

4B76C53D2FD03BDE0876858296084C296C96444ECEF05AB7B6A8666D1E451622E83F495C3D9E41CBD8755F803C7894B7292E2C42910854508308ABF9CBABEA0E

Validator #2 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#2 signature

A00AE28AB00A107F35427B834539B1D25A239138C67C1316F46E1654510D1A6A3E9547EB5B5FDAB4080A183EE611146C1F9E5B9015EB69E0400245730A4FC30B